The Project CUBE desires to support artists to acquire competences and knowledge, including digital competences and entrepreneurial spirit, in order to reinforce creativity, innovation and sustainability in the cultural and creative sector.
The objectives are:
- Promoting the upskilling pathways of adult artists and low-skilled culture workers, through the adoption of a virtual training programme.
- Enhancing inclusion of all adult artists in society and eliminating risk of poverty and job loss.
- Encouraging new entrepreneurial ideas related to the cultural and artistic sector, revealing new methods of funding.
- Creating cultural incubators leading to higher employability of adult artists.
Project results:
- Open educational resources are going to be developed
- training of at least 20 adult artists in each participating country
- At least 10 trainers will be included to shape the training programme from all CUBE’s partner countries
- At least 80 adult artists and low-skilled workers will be benefited from CUBE’s results
- More than 200 uses of O.E.R are going to be achieved
- 1 paneuropean best practices’ report which will identifies relevant good examples of cultural incubators in COVID-19 pandemic
- Production of 6 national Field research reports, with which the consortium will identify relevant good practices
- Development of a training programme which will consists of at least 4 modules in entrepreneurship
- Design of 1 OER platform which will serve as the basic tool for disseminating information and results
- Uploading of at least 50 bibliographical resources and case studies in the library repository
- Involvement of at least 50 SMEs and stakeholders related to artists’ employability(in total)
- At least 50 artistic associations in a Paneuropean scale will be benefited
- 1 dedicated project website with information about the partnership and the project results to be created.
